To his right sits a young girl, seemingly lost in her own world. She reclines on what appears to be a draped cushion or small platform, her gaze directed upwards towards the man’s face. Her pose is relaxed, almost languid, and she wears a simple white garment that contrasts sharply with the kings elaborate clothing. The placement of the girl suggests vulnerability and innocence in contrast to the power embodied by the older figure.
The landscape serves as more than just a backdrop; it contributes significantly to the painting’s atmosphere. Jagged peaks rise in the distance, partially obscured by clouds tinged with pink and orange hues. This creates a sense of grandeur and remoteness, hinting at an epic scale for the narrative unfolding before us. The lower portion of the scene depicts a dark, rocky terrain, adding depth and grounding the figures within their environment.
Subtleties in the interaction between the two characters invite interpretation. The king’s hand is raised towards the girls face, but it is not clear whether this gesture signifies affection, warning, or something more ambiguous. The girl’s expression is difficult to discern; she appears neither frightened nor overtly joyful, which leaves her emotional state open to speculation.
The painting seems to explore themes of power and innocence, age and youth, and the potential for both connection and conflict between them. The contrast in their attire and posture underscores these thematic tensions, while the dramatic landscape reinforces a sense of timelessness and mythic significance. It is likely that this work intends to depict a moment of pivotal importance within a larger narrative – a meeting that holds profound implications for the characters involved and perhaps for the world they inhabit.
